CSR MANGROVE REPLANTING
CARGILL MALAYSIA
by Wetlands International Malaysia

Date   : 8th June 2023, Thursday

Time   : 9:00 AM – 12:30 PM

Venue : Pusat Pendidikan Kecil Hutan Paya Laut, Nibong Tebal, Pulau Pinang

Wetlands International together with our partner Penang Inshore Fisherman Welfare Association (PIFWA) coordinated a mangrove replanting activity for Cargill Malaysia under their CSR programme.   Participants from Cargill Malaysia were first given a brief introduction from Mr. Ilias Shafie, President of (PIFWA) on the mangroves in Nibong Tebal, Pulau Pinang and their conservation works in protecting and maintaining the coastal ecosystem there.

He also gave a safety briefing on “Dos and Don’ts” during replanting activity at the site. Participants were required to wear the provided rubber boots and gloves.

The replanting site is located at the mangrove forest along the Sungai Chenaam, where the area plays a vital role as the habitat of diverse flora and fauna. The mangroves here also serve as the source of livelihood for the local communities around the area. A total of 500 mangrove seedlings; Bakau minyak (Rhizophora species) and Api-api (Avicennia species) were replanted. Besides this, the participants also helped to clean-up around the mangrove site.  They collected three bags full of trash!

By holding such activities we hope that corporate organisations and others will learn to appreciate the environment and especially the mangroves in this case and our their production activities can minimise impact on these unique ecosystems.
